This 12 Days India & Nepal Buddhist Pilgrimage Tour follows one of the most meaningful Buddhist routes in South Asia, linking the major sacred places associated with the Buddha's life and teachings. The journey connects Shravasti, Lumbini, Kushinagar, Vaishali, Nalanda, Rajgir, Bodh Gaya, Varanasi and Sarnath.
The route is especially suitable for travellers who want to include both the Buddha's birthplace at Lumbini and the core Buddhist circuit of India in one private pilgrimage. It combines sacred sites, archaeological remains, monastery traditions and time for reflection, while keeping the overland sequence practical and logically connected.
The pilgrimage begins in Delhi and continues via Lucknow to Shravasti, where the Buddha spent many monsoon retreats at Jetavana. From there, the route crosses into Nepal for two nights in Lumbini, giving enough time for the Maya Devi Temple, Sacred Garden, Ashokan Pillar and international monastic zone.
Returning to India, the journey continues to Kushinagar, associated with the Buddha's Mahaparinirvana, and then through Vaishali, Nalanda and Rajgir. These sites form an important bridge between the Buddha's later life, monastic communities and the long tradition of Buddhist learning in eastern India.
Two nights in Bodh Gaya allow the Mahabodhi Temple and Bodhi Tree to be experienced at a slower pace. The pilgrimage finishes in Varanasi with a dedicated visit to Sarnath, where the Buddha delivered his first teaching. Begin with the major Buddhist sites of Shravasti.
Visit the Jetavana Monastery area, where the Buddha is traditionally associated with many monsoon retreats and teachings.
Explore selected remains within the Saheth-Maheth archaeological landscape and allow time for quiet reflection where practical.

Spend the day exploring Lumbini, traditionally recognised as the birthplace of Siddhartha Gautama.
Visit the Maya Devi Temple and Sacred Garden, with time around the marker stone, sacred pond and Ashokan Pillar according to current site access.
Continue through the wider monastic zone, where Buddhist communities from different countries have established temples and monasteries representing diverse traditions.

Begin with the principal Buddhist sites of Kushinagar.
Visit the Mahaparinirvana Temple and reclining Buddha image, followed by Ramabhar Stupa and selected monastic or archaeological sites.

After breakfast, drive to Sarnath.
Visit Dhamek Stupa and the archaeological area associated with the Buddha's first teaching after enlightenment.
Continue to Chaukhandi Stupa, selected monastery areas and the museum or interpretation centre according to current opening conditions.
Your guide will explain the Deer Park tradition, the first turning of the Dharma wheel and the beginnings of the Buddhist Sangha.
